Viktor Vasilyevich Kurenkov (born 18 September 1949) — head of the local self-government of Pavlovsky District since 1995.
Education
Gorky Polytechnic Institute (1978), mechanical engineer.
Previous places of work
1966-1980 – fitter, deputy head of production at the Vorsma Works named after V.I. Lenin; 1980-1988 – chairman of the executive committee of the Vorsma city soviet (town council); 1988-1995 – first deputy head of the administration of Pavlovsky District.
State awards
Medal “For Valiant Labour in Commemoration of the 100th Anniversary of the Birth of V.I. Lenin”, Order of Friendship.
